Finance director reports FY25 preliminary results; board approves audit submission

Summary

The district reported year-to-date totals for fiscal 2025: consolidated revenues $334.94 million, expenditures $361.77 million, a net change of -$26.42 million driven largely by capital project spending. The general fund had an unassigned balance of $35.4 million (about 13%). The board approved transmitting the financials to auditors.

The district’s finance director presented preliminary fiscal-year financials and asked the board to approve forwarding the records for the formal audit.

What the report showed

- All funds (year-to-date): revenue $334,937,053; expenditures $361,774,793; other financing sources $16,000,075; net change in fund balance -$26,420,765 (primarily capital project and bond spending).

- General Fund: revenue $278,247,344; expenditures $272,078,989; net change in fund balance -$3,585,224. The board had previously budgeted to use reserves; additional revenues (taxes, enrollment and interest) reduced the reserve draw.

- Fund balance: total general fund balance $43,384,570; after commitments and encumbrances the unassigned fund balance is $35,401,821 (about a 13% reserve).

Audit and next steps

The finance director said an external audit engagement will proceed in November and that the final audited financial statements will be posted to the state auditor and on the district website once complete. Board members asked whether the audit is independent; staff confirmed it is an external audit procured per state requirements. The board voted to approve submission of the financial report for audit.

Board action

A member moved and the board approved the finance report for audit submission; the finance staff will deliver the audited report after the external audit is complete and publish it as required by state guidance.
